The couch to 5k (often shortened to ‘c25k) program is a free running plan designed to get people from a complete running newbie. The nhs c25k plan is designed to help you develop your fitness to the point of being able to run five kilometres without any breaks. To recap our guide on the couch the 5k plan, these are the 5 mistakes to avoid: This couch to 5k running plan is designed to get beginners off their couch and running for 5k (3.1 miles) in 9 weeks on a treadmill. The 5k is short for five kilometers, where one kilometer is equivalent to 0.62 of a mile, making a 5k race 3.1 miles in length.
